CASSETTE TYPE 2 SENSORS. (B21 and B22).

Purpose
This adjustment ensures that both TYPE 2 SENSORS recognise the TYPE 2 STICKER on the
CASSETTE. If the SENSORS are not adjusted correctly a normal CASSETTE may be
detected as a TYPE 2 CASSETTE.
Note
·
This adjustment is only possible if PCB A8 carries the INDEX B. This INDEX is printed at
the bottom right corner (after the number) of the PCB. PCB's with the INDEX A do not
have the necessary potentiometers. These PCBs were only used on the very first
XML300s.
·
Avoid bright sunlight. It may cause wrong results when you measure the output voltage of
SENSORS B21 and B22.
1
.
Take off the TOP-, REAR-, and RIGHT-HAND PANEL of the XML300.
2.
Manually feed in a CASSETTE with 2 TYPE 2 reflective STICKERS and centre it.
This ensures that the TYPE 2 SENSORS B21 and B22 are correct at the TYPE 2
Warning
STICKERS.
Be careful when operating the CASSETTE OPENER. Make sure that no one's hands are in
the CASSETTE AREA
3
.
Start the SENSOR TEST.
Press ESCAPE twice
Start the SERVICE PROGRAM.
Select SERVICE MODE from the GLOBAL MENU ....................................... press ENTER
ENTER SERVICE MODE MESSAGE is displayed............................................ press ENTER
UNIT DATA are displayed ................................................................................ press ENTER
Select COMPONENT TEST from the MAIN MENU ....................................... press ENTER
Select SENSORS .................................................................................................. press ENTER
Select SENSOR TEST with SOUND ................................................................... press ENTER
